The latest Sidecarist magazine, volume 47, issue 6 (Nov/Dec 2023) has been mailed out (or about to be)!

As a sneak preview for members, and an introduction and sample of the magazine for prospective new members, here is the cover and contents. The Sidecarist Magazine is one of the benefits of being a member of the United Sidecar Association (USCA). To sign up go to https://sidecar.com/usca-membership/
